Hugh Jackman and Deborra-Lee Furness shocked the entertainment world when they recently announced their separation after 27 years of marriage. This surprising news left fans and followers wondering about the reasons behind the decision and how it would affect their family. Since their announcement, both Hugh and Deborra-Lee have maintained their silence, but Hugh has recently emerged on social media, giving us a heartfelt glimpse into their family home.

In his latest Instagram post, Hugh Jackman shared an emotional tribute to their adorable French bulldog, Dali, who passed away in August 2022. The photo shows a sweet throwback image of Hugh gazing up at the camera, accompanied by the caption, “Happy birthday Dali!” It is clear that Dali held a special place in their hearts, and his passing has been a profound loss for the entire Jackman family.

When Dali passed away on August 6, Hugh expressed his deep sadness, describing it as a “very sad day” for their family. He affectionately referred to Dali as the “ROCKSTAR” and shared fond memories of their beloved pet. Hugh acknowledged that Dali had a unique personality, marching to the beat of his own drum and being adored by people around the world. Despite their grief, Hugh found solace in knowing that Dali was now in a better place, ruling the roost and enjoying endless indulgences. The tribute concluded with a heartfelt farewell, “RIP Dali Rockstar Jackman. We love you!”

Dali, who was adopted by the Jackman family in 2010, quickly became a cherished member of their household. His presence was frequently showcased on Hugh’s social media, where he appeared in various outings alongside the Marvel star. Dali’s joyful and vibrant personality undoubtedly brought immense happiness to the family.

On September 15, news broke that Hugh and Deborra-Lee would be parting ways after almost three decades of marriage. Their statement emphasized that their family would remain their highest priority, and they expressed gratitude, love, and kindness toward one another as they embarked on separate journeys. It is evident that their decision was made with careful consideration and a desire for personal growth.

Hugh and Deborra-Lee have two children together, son Oscar Maximillian Jackman, 23, and daughter Ava Eliot Jackman, 18. Both children were adopted by the couple as babies. In a 2012 interview with Katie Couric, Hugh shared their longstanding desire to adopt, emphasizing that it had always been a part of their plans, even before facing challenges with conception. The adoption process brought immense joy and fulfillment to their lives, shaping their family into what it is today.
